About This Book

The Element explores the point at which natural talent meets personal passion. Ken Robinson argues that finding this intersection is essential for achieving personal fulfillment and success. Through inspiring stories of artists, scientists, and entrepreneurs, Robinson illustrates how discovering one’s Element can transform both individual lives and organizations.

At the heart of this book lies a simple but profound idea: the Element is the meeting point between natural aptitude and personal passion. Aptitude is what you’re naturally good at—it’s an expression of your unique intelligence, your ability to think and act in ways that come intuitively. Passion is what excites you, what gives you a sense of vitality and purpose. When these two forces intersect, something remarkable happens: you unlock your deepest creative potential.

Throughout history, many extraordinary people have found this intersection and built lives defined by joy and mastery. Think of Paul McCartney, who discovered music as his natural language; or Gillian Lynne, the celebrated choreographer, whose restless energy in school turned out to be a gift of movement and expression. They didn’t merely succeed; they thrived because they operated from the space where talent and love merge.

Finding your Element is not about conforming to external expectations; it’s about rediscovering who you are. Society often values limited categories—academic achievement, financial success, conventional intelligence—but human capacity is far more diverse. The Element honors that diversity. It says you flourish when you recognize your unique blend of abilities and follow the things that truly inspire your heart.

This concept is both liberating and demanding. It calls us to look beyond the superficial goals that dominate modern life and instead to pursue authenticity. Every person has the potential for greatness, not because of status or wealth, but because within each of us lies something deeply original waiting to be expressed.

People who find their Element don’t simply work—they live with energy and purpose. Their days are charged with creativity, persistence, and joy. They lose track of time not because they’re distracted, but because they are immersed. According to psychologists, this state resembles 'flow,' a condition of total involvement in which our talents are stretched to meet our challenges. But beyond the psychological description, it feels like home.

When you find your Element, your motivation changes. You don’t need someone else to push you; the drive comes from within. That’s why most high achievers are self-motivated—they love what they do. Consider people like Mick Fleetwood, who could hardly pay attention in school but became a legendary drummer; or Matt Groening, whose doodles once annoyed teachers but later evolved into 'The Simpsons.' Their accomplishments aren’t coincidences—they stem from aligning their innate abilities with their passions.

Finding your Element also affects how you perceive others. When you understand the power of passion and aptitude working together, you start to see potential everywhere—in your colleagues, your children, your friends. It broadens your appreciation for human variety. And once you find it, life seems to take on an internal coherence: you understand yourself not as a cog in a system, but as a creative being with your own voice.

About the Author

K
Ken Robinson

Sir Ken Robinson (1950–2020) was a British author, speaker, and international advisor on education in the arts. He was known for his influential work on creativity and innovation in education and business, including his widely viewed TED Talk 'Do Schools Kill Creativity?'.
